Hall Floor Defects Not Minor

LVT Number: 10724

Tenants complained of a reduction in building-wide services. The DRA ruled for tenants and reduced their rents. Landlord appealed. One of the conditions on which the rent reductions were based was that the hallway flooring showed cracking with holes. Landlord claimed that this was a minor condition not warranting a rent reduction. The DHCR ruled against landlord. This wasn't a minor condition under DHCR guidelines.
